- [ ] **Step 7: Breaker override escrow.** After sealing the signing keys for the Tallgrove upstream API circuit breaker, confirm the support team can force the breaker open during a full outage. The override bundle lives in the sealed escrow drawer and is useless without its unlock phrase. Two ceremony witnesses must initial this step before proceeding. The escrow bundle is decrypted with the recovery passphrase that follows.

vault phrase of kahip-kahop = holath-quenmir

UserSplit Cutover Drift: the extracted account service and the legacy Marigold monolith user module are reporting divergent record counts during dual-write. This fires when drift exceeds 0.5% over 15 minutes. New team members should not replay writes manually. Reconciliation steps and the rollback procedure are documented on the internal page.

wiki page, tajog-fafog: https://gitlab.paliqsys.corp/dash/display/job/853dd6fcbf54

## Artifact Signing: TraceWeave Builds

The TraceWeave service propagates request IDs across all Lumenor microservices, and its release artifacts must be signed before the span-collector will accept them. Reviewers should confirm the build was produced by the hermetic pipeline and that trace-context headers are unchanged in the manifest. Unsigned artifacts are rejected at ingest, which silently drops cross-service correlation. Sign each bundle with the key below before promoting to staging.

release key, fajof-fawef: bky19_jNcDy5ia68rvEn25WjQ

## Deploying the Gatewick Proctor Queue

Deploys are pretty painless: push to main, wait for the pipeline, then watch the queue drain dashboard for five minutes. If candidates pile up mid-exam, roll back first and ask questions later — the queue replays safely. Everything the workers care about lives in one config block, shown here for reference.

settings of bafof-yagef:
JOROX_PIN=8740
JOROX_TENANT=pelox
JOROX_METRICS_HOST=metrics.jorox.qorvelworks.internal
JOROX_SEAL=seal_c78f63c1
JOROX_STANDBY_TEAM=norax